Abstract

This research aims to analyze the problems in Covid-19 and Human Rights. This research is a normative juridical research that is descriptive in nature, and uses a prescriptive form with the aim of problem solution. The data used is secondary data which is analyzed qualitatively. The results of this study show that there are many problems that arise as a result of the Covid-19 pandemic and only the State can make policies to deal with the Covid-19 pandemic in accordance with human rights or not. The state should be wise in making policies whose contents are in accordance with human rights to deal with and deal with Covid-19. “Covid-19 does not discriminate, neither Should We”.
